DescriptionRp-Adenosine-5'-O-(1-thiotriphosphate) (Rp-ATP-α-S), a sulfur-containing nucleotide derivative isomer and a purinergic P2Y1 receptor agonist, promotes calcium mobilization in HEK293 cells expressing the human P2Y1 receptor (EC50 = 75 nM). This compound exhibits binding affinity to washed isolated human platelets (Ki = 156 nM) and attenuates ADP-induced aggregation in human platelet-rich plasma (PRP; pA2 = 4.74), as well as inhibits cAMP production triggered by prostaglandin E1 (PGE1) in human PRP (pA2 = 5.26). Furthermore, it triggers relaxation in carbamoylcholine-constricted guinea pig taenia coli strips (EC50 = 56 nM). Rp-ATP-α-S also contributes to the synthesis of cyclic dinucleotides, recognized by bacterial riboswitches.
